Understanding Premium Sliding Door Technology
The technology behind premium sliding doors is sophisticated, focusing on both performance and usability. Learn more about premium sliding doors. Unlike conventional sliding doors, lift and slide doors incorporate a lifting mechanism that allows the door panels to be elevated slightly off their tracks. This innovation not only minimizes the stress on the hardware but also ensures a longer lifespan of the system. Additionally, these doors often feature multi-point locking systems, enhancing security and stability at crucial points along the frame. Furthermore, premium sliding doors typically utilize high-quality materials, including thermally broken aluminum, which enhances insulation and energy efficiency in aluminium lift and slide doors with thermal efficiency. The National Fenestration Rating Council emphasizes the importance of energy ratings, and lift and slide doors can achieve excellent scores when manufactured with great care. Thermally Broken Lift and Slide Doors: Energy Efficiency for Your Climate
Thermally broken lift and slide doors represent a crucial advancement in energy-efficient building solutions. By incorporating a thermal break in the design, manufacturers can significantly reduce heat transfer between the interior and exterior. This features innovative materials that act as insulators, thereby enhancing energy efficiency and reducing energy costs for homeowners. Particularly in areas with extreme temperatures, these doors can help maintain a consistent indoor climate, making them invaluable during cold winters and hot summers. Aluminium lift and slide doors use a mechanical system that simplifies movement of heavy panels. Turning the handle raises the door slightly from its track, which cuts friction and allows smooth gliding even with large sizes. The lift also creates a tight seal when the door closes, improving weather resistance. This design supports effortless opening and closing without excessive force. The aluminium frame adds strength while resisting corrosion from outdoor exposure. Regular track cleaning maintains performance over years of use. These doors work well for patios and extensions where wide, easy-access openings are needed.
Premium sliding doors are built for energy efficiency through several integrated features. Multiple glazing with low-emissivity coatings retains indoor heat during cold months and reduces solar gain in summer. Effective seals around frames limit air leaks and drafts. Thermal breaks within the structure minimize heat transfer through the material. Together these elements help cut heating and cooling expenses. Correct installation ensures the full benefit is achieved. Users typically experience more stable room temperatures and lower utility costs after fitting. The doors also improve comfort by reducing cold spots near large openings.
